Working within a small team of Field Service coordinators, you will receive service requests from both internal and external customers and be expected to provide an efficient and effective service.

You will be responsible to plan, schedule and prioritise all service and maintenance calls for our customers all over the UK and to coordinate our team of Service Technicians to carry these out to maximum efficiency.

Key Responsibilities
Raise service calls using our scheduling software and communicate the anticipated repair pathway
Effective triage of service requests to ensure relevant information is gathered and accurately recorded to support the "first time fix" of plant in the field
Develop a good understanding of our equipment (for which training will be provided), encourage and assist our customers in diagnosing and where possible, resolve faults remotely
Dispatch service calls to a team of Field Service Technicians using our scheduling software
Communicate with customers to keep them updated and informed of any changes to the agreed pathway
Review all calls throughout the day and highlight key learning points
Daily reporting of any issues to the Field Service Manager.
Following internal processes and procedures to ensure a consistently high level of service.
